Why Does An Electric Kettle Keep Switching Off

2026-07-14

An electric kettle automatically switching off is usually related to safety protection, temperature control, power connection, or internal component performance. Automatic shut-off is an important function designed to protect users and improve appliance safety, but frequent switching off before boiling may indicate a product or usage issue.

Common Reasons Why An Electric Kettle Keeps Switching Off

Several factors may cause an electric kettle to stop repeatedly.

Possible CauseImpact
Low water levelActivates dry boil protection
Scale buildupAffects temperature detection
Faulty thermostatStops heating too early
Poor electrical connectionInterrupts power supply
Component agingReduces operating stability

Understanding these causes helps identify whether the issue comes from maintenance, operating conditions, or product performance.

Safety Protection Systems In electric kettles

Modern electric kettles are designed with multiple safety functions to reduce risks during operation.

Common protection features include:

Automatic Steam Power Off

When water reaches boiling temperature, steam activates the control system and automatically stops heating.

Dry Boil Protection

If there is insufficient water inside the kettle, the system stops operation to prevent overheating.

High Temperature Fuse Protection

A thermal fuse provides additional protection when abnormal temperatures occur.
